On August 31, the Ministry of Commerce, together with the National Development and Reform Commission, the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ology, the Ministry of Finance, the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s, the Ministry of Culture and Tourism, and the State Administration for Market Regulation, issued the Implementation Opinions on Promoting the Expansion and Upgrade of Commodity Consumption. An official from the Department of Consumption Promotion under the Ministry of Commerce stated that the Opinions set out four major tasks to boost commodity consumption:

Promote consumption of bulk durable goods – advance pilot reforms in automobile circulation and consumption to expand auto consumption across the entire chain, and accelerate the promotion and application of smart home products.

Steadily increase consumption of daily necessities – improve the quality of food, beverages, textiles and apparel, as well as cultural, sports and entertainment products.

Support consumption of specialty goods – focus on the needs of the elderly and children by boosting silver economy and infant/child products; encourage consumption of trendy domestic brands, high-quality export products, and premium international goods.

Foster consumption of upgraded products – in line with evolving consumer demand, promote green, smart, and health-oriented products.

【Key Hub Station of "Gansu Power to Zhejiang" Project Rushes Toward Final Acceptance】 At the construction site of the Shuiyuan 750 kV substation in Yongchang County, Jinchang City, Gansu Province, staff from State Grid Gansu Extra-High Voltage Company are systematically carrying out electrical equipment acceptance, pre-operation preparations, and technical supervision work. The substation serves as a key supporting project for the "Gansu Power to Zhejiang" transmission route and serves as a pivotal hub interconnection station in the Hexi region. Once completed, it will integrate wind and solar clean energy from Jinchang and Wuwei, optimize the grid structure of the Hexi area, and enhance the capacity for new energy consumption and green power transmission.

【South Korea and the U.S. Discuss Energy Cooperation Amid Growing Uncertainties】 According to Yonhap News Agency, officials from South Korea's climate and energy department stated on Monday that the two sides discussed ways to strengthen bilateral cooperation in the energy sector against the backdrop of escalating uncertainties in the global market. According to South Korea's Ministry of Climate, Energy, and Environment, Second Vice Minister Lee Ho-hyeon met with U.S. official Kirk Cochrane in Seoul, where they discussed policy measures to ensure the stability of energy supply chains and electricity supply. The ministry also stated that the two sides exchanged views on major energy security issues requiring joint responses, including ensuring grid safety amid rapidly growing electricity demand and the continuous expansion of energy storage systems. Lee Ho-hyeon remarked: "Ensuring the stability of energy supply chains and electricity supply is a pillar of a nation's industrial competitiveness. We hope that this meeting will help both countries jointly address intensifying market uncertainties and strengthen bilateral energy cooperation."

Cornex New Energy's 70GWh lithium battery industrial park in Xiangyang, Hubei officially started production on Aug 30, completing its one-headquarters-plus-four-bases layout. Construction began on Oct 28, 2025, and first products rolled off the line in just 10 months, two months ahead of schedule. Covering 1,608 mu with 1.05 million sqm of floor space, the base targets both energy storage and EV applications, mass-producing 100Ah, 588Ah, 648Ah and larger storage cells plus high-rate fast-charging power batteries. At full capacity it will ship nearly 400,000 cells daily worldwide, with annual output value expected to exceed RMB 30bn and over 5,000 jobs created.
